在織夢ddedecms建站的時候用到內(nèi)容模型是常見的事情,但是要用的模型不一定就是系統(tǒng)中有的那些,可能需要自己自定義一些模型,那就相應(yīng)的需要自己定義那些字段,在調(diào)用代碼插入到模板中的時候就需要根據(jù)自己定義的字段能調(diào)用出相對應(yīng)的結(jié)果。 1、進(jìn)織夢DedeCms后臺點擊“核心 -> 頻道模型 -> 內(nèi)容模型管理”。 這樣就會看到織夢DedeCms集成的幾個內(nèi)容模板,比如商品、圖片集、文章和軟件之類的,在右上角就有個“增加新模型”,在這里添加你需要定義的模型,然后只需要填寫頻道名稱就可以了。 2、在定義的模型中會有自己需要調(diào)用的字段,字段名稱這個是在模板文件里面調(diào)用該字段內(nèi)容時需要用到的字段名。 ![]() (此圖片來源于網(wǎng)絡(luò),如有侵權(quán),請聯(lián)系刪除! ) 圖1 ![]() (此圖片來源于網(wǎng)絡(luò),如有侵權(quán),請聯(lián)系刪除! ) 圖2 3、字段就算添加完了,用普通文章模型發(fā)表文章的時候,就會看到多出了一個優(yōu)惠價的框,讓我們填入我們需要調(diào)用的字段。 ![]() (此圖片來源于網(wǎng)絡(luò),如有侵權(quán),請聯(lián)系刪除! ) 圖3 4、接著就得把該字段的內(nèi)容給調(diào)用到頁面上,分為兩種,一種是用list標(biāo)簽調(diào)用的,領(lǐng)一種是用arclist標(biāo)簽調(diào)用的,不過調(diào)用方式都一樣。 我們在文章頁調(diào)用就用如下代碼: {dede:arclist row=8 titlelen=32 addfields=’youhuijia’ channelid=’17′}
在{dede:arclist row=6 titlelen=32}處多出了addfields=’youhuijia’ channelid=’17′ ,其中addfields=’youhuijia’表示的是指定要獲得的字段 addfields=’字段1,字段’ channelid=’17′ 表示的是該字段是屬于哪個模型的,”17″為該模型的模型ID,我們在普通文章模型里面添加的字段,所以所以channelid=的值為17 。 在內(nèi)容模型管理里面就會看到內(nèi)容模型的ID。 ![]() (此圖片來源于網(wǎng)絡(luò),如有侵權(quán),請聯(lián)系刪除! ) 圖4 在列表頁的調(diào)用方式也一樣,標(biāo)簽改為list即可,但前臺參數(shù)需選中“使字段可以在列表的底層模板中獲得”這樣就可以在列表中調(diào)用該字段。 {dede:list row=8 titlelen=32 addfields=’youhuijia’ channelid=’17′}
|
免責(zé)聲明:本站部分文章和圖片均來自用戶投稿和網(wǎng)絡(luò)收集,旨在傳播知識,文章和圖片版權(quán)歸原作者及原出處所有,僅供學(xué)習(xí)與參考,請勿用于商業(yè)用途,如果損害了您的權(quán)利,請聯(lián)系我們及時修正或刪除。謝謝!
始終以前瞻性的眼光聚焦站長、創(chuàng)業(yè)、互聯(lián)網(wǎng)等領(lǐng)域,為您提供最新最全的互聯(lián)網(wǎng)資訊,幫助站長轉(zhuǎn)型升級,為互聯(lián)網(wǎng)創(chuàng)業(yè)者提供更加優(yōu)質(zhì)的創(chuàng)業(yè)信息和品牌營銷服務(wù),與站長一起進(jìn)步!讓互聯(lián)網(wǎng)創(chuàng)業(yè)者不再孤獨!
掃一掃,關(guān)注站長網(wǎng)微信